Damage propagation analyses of CFRP laminated OHT test specimens with gap defects

Abstract

CFRP laminated composite structures manufactured by Automated Fiber Placement (AFP) may have gap and overlap defects and these potentially affect the strength of the structures. This study aims the development of finite element analysis models, which can consider strength reduction due to such defects. This paper proposes the modeling method considering ply-thickness variation induced by gap defects and shows the numerical results obtained by damage propagation analyses for the Open Hole Tensile Test of CFRP laminate with a gap defect.
